Arabian Partridge vs Broad-leaf Featherbush
Alectoris melanocephala compared with Aulax umbellata
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Arabian Partridge | Broad-leaf Featherbush |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) |
| Order | Galliformes (Galliformes) | Proteales (Proteales) |
| Family | Phasianidae | Proteaceae |
| Genus | Alectoris | Aulax |
| Species | Alectoris melanocephala | Aulax umbellata |
